Why use a random emoji picker?
Emojis add personality to content, but choosing them manually can be slow and repetitive. A random picker lets you explore unexpected combinations, break creative blocks, and quickly populate mockups with realistic emoji content.
Choosing the right category
- Smileys & Emotions: ideal for reaction content, social posts, and chat interfaces.
- Animals & Nature: great for nature blogs, eco brands, and educational content.
- Food & Drink: perfect for restaurants, recipe blogs, and food delivery apps.
- Travel & Places: useful for travel guides, hotel apps, and location-based content.
- Objects: helpful for tech mockups, product listings, and utility apps.
- Symbols: best for UI iconography concepts and sign-language content.
- Activities: good for sports, fitness, and hobby platforms.
- People & Body: suited for HR tools, diversity content, and accessibility demos.
- Any: fully random mix — great for surprise or discovery experiences.
